This is the first piece of sewing/work produced in my new sewing room. I have done this as a brief diversion of trying to fit all my stuff into the new room. I have always loved the designs by Liberty of London. This piece is furnishing cotton and was owned by my late mother. She made it originally into a summer skirt and years later used some of it to make a small cushion cover. It had been sewn by hand but I have redone it by machine and added a zip as there were ribbons. The fabric design is Ianthe. Thanks for looking
